antiX 17, a Linux distribution without systemd, is released

Accepted submission by Anonymous Coward at 2017-11-01 11:09:30
OS

The antiX Linux project announced [antixlinux.com] version 17 of its distribution.

The developers of the Debian-based antiX GNU/Linux distribution announced the release of antiX 17, dubbed "Heather Heyer" and based on the Debian GNU/Linux 9.2 "Stretch" operating system.

antiX 17 follows the trend of previous versions to offer users an operating system that does not include the widely used systemd init system. With this release, Gentoo's eudev device file manager for the Linux kernel is used by default instead of udev.

source: Softpedia News [softpedia.com]

Eudev [github.com] is a fork of udev, made by the Gentoo project to avoid dependency on systemd.
